The Bust of Zeus from Otricoli is a Roman sculpture portraying the mighty Greek god Zeus. Carved from white marble, this bust is a work of remarkable detail and expression. Zeus’s head is sculpted with a majestic seriousness, with slightly furrowed brows reflecting his divine authority. His eyes, though now empty, undoubtedly once held a penetrating gaze signifying wisdom and power.
The nose, though partially eroded by the passage of time, still retains its noble and regal shape. Zeus’s mouth is sculpted in a solemn expression, with lips barely parted as if about to utter a divine decree. His beard and hair are depicted in intricate detail, with elaborate curls and strands elegantly cascading over his shoulders. Although a Roman work, it is a copy based on Zeus.
The Bust of Zeus rests upon a muscular neck, suggesting his physical prowess, and is crowned with a diadem or crown, symbolizing his sovereignty over gods and men. Overall, the Bust of Zeus from Otricoli is an impressive work that captures the majesty and power of the king of the gods in Greek mythology.
His serene yet imposing expression makes it a standout piece for both its artistic beauty and symbolic significance. Although the Bust of Zeus from Otricoli is inspired by the statue of Zeus at Olympia, one of the Seven Wonders of the Ancient World, created by the famous Greek sculptor Phidias. The bust of Zeus from Otricoli dates from the 1st century CE.
